问题描述:

我按照这个教程http://www.allappsdevelopers.com/TopicDetail.aspx?TopicID=c16ed3b4-b422-43ba-b595-ee8e21dd1854问题是当我捕捉图像是默认显示大小如此之大但全部放大缩小如何设置默认大小为正常图像大小?如何设置缩小放大和缩小放大缩小尺寸?

public boolean onTouch(View v, MotionEvent event) { 

     ImageView view = (ImageView) v; 

     view.setScaleType(ImageView.ScaleType.MATRIX); 

     float scale; 



     // Dump touch event to log 

     dumpEvent(event); 



     // Handle touch events here... 

     switch (event.getAction() & MotionEvent.ACTION_MASK) { 



     case MotionEvent.ACTION_DOWN: //first finger down only 

      savedMatrix.set(matrix); 

      start.set(event.getX(), event.getY()); 

      Log.d(TAG, "mode=DRAG"); 

      mode = DRAG; 

      break; 

     case MotionEvent.ACTION_UP: //first finger lifted 

     case MotionEvent.ACTION_POINTER_UP: //second finger lifted 

      mode = NONE; 

      Log.d(TAG, "mode=NONE"); 

      break; 

     case MotionEvent.ACTION_POINTER_DOWN: //second finger down 

      oldDist = spacing(event); 

      Log.d(TAG, "oldDist=" + oldDist); 

      if (oldDist > 5f) { 

      savedMatrix.set(matrix); 

      midPoint(mid, event); 

      mode = ZOOM; 

      Log.d(TAG, "mode=ZOOM"); 

      } 

      break; 



     case MotionEvent.ACTION_MOVE: 

      if (mode == DRAG) { //movement of first finger 

      matrix.set(savedMatrix); 

      if (view.getLeft() >= -392){ 

       matrix.postTranslate(event.getX() - start.x, event.getY() - 
    start.y); 

      } 

      } 

      else if (mode == ZOOM) { //pinch zooming 

      float newDist = spacing(event); 

      Log.d(TAG, "newDist=" + newDist); 

      if (newDist > 5f) { 

       matrix.set(savedMatrix); 

       scale = newDist/oldDist; /*thinking i need to play around 
    with this value to limit it*/ 

       matrix.postScale(scale, scale, mid.x, mid.y); 

      } 

      } 

      break; 

     } 



     // Perform the transformation 

     view.setImageMatrix(matrix); 



     return true; // indicate event was handled 

    } 



    private float spacing(MotionEvent event) { 

     float x = event.getX(0) - event.getX(1); 

     float y = event.getY(0) - event.getY(1); 

     return FloatMath.sqrt(x * x + y * y); 

    } 



    private void midPoint(PointF point, MotionEvent event) { 

     float x = event.getX(0) + event.getX(1); 

     float y = event.getY(0) + event.getY(1); 

     point.set(x/2, y/2); 

    }

float initialZoomLevel = 0.5f; 
matrix.setScale(initialZoomLevel, initialZoomLevel); 
view.setImageMatrix(matrix); 

把这个构造函数/动初始化方法为您的图像视图。这将导致图像立即以1/2尺寸显示。任何进一步的修改的图像应该在同一矩阵

public boolean onTouch(View v, MotionEvent event) { 
    matrix = view.getImageMatrix() 
    //.. now do zooming, etc on this matrix 
} 

这样的方式来完成,图像的“默认”大小设置为原来的一半。希望这可以帮助!
